| Posted: Thu Sep 03, 2015 9:01 am Post subject: BG 1209/2, flashing when cold |
|
|
So after replacing the H-board everything was fine. https://www.curtpalme.com/forum_archived/viewtopic.php@t=37632.html
After a few weeks, a similar but non the less different problem started. Whenever the projector is cold, the image flicker in brightness. The red LED on the H-board does not light up and the projector keeps scanning. Both internal patterns, on screen menus and external sources are affected. No difference what resolution I run. H-size is also too small when cold.
If I let it heat up for about 5-10 minutes the problems slowly becomes less and less to go away completely and H-size is what I set it to.
I tried blasting the boards one by one with freeze spray to see if I can trigger a flicker but no luck. Felt reluctant to run the EHT and SMPS too cold with my face nearby and I haven't reached into the neckboards and motherboard.
Any educated guesses?
